Mr. Johnson is also comparing the two mobile phone data plans. Talk First charges $20 plus $5 per GB of data, while Mobile Plus charges $30 plus $3 per GB of data. At what amount of GB use will the cost of the two data plans be the same? Mr. Johnson wrote this equation for the scenario. 1. d = amount of data used (GB)

2. Talk First = Mobile Plus

3. 20d + 5 = 30d + 3

Analyze Mr. Johnson’s work and identify his mistake.

In step 1, his variable should be c, representing company.
In step 2, his translated equation should be Talk First + Mobile Plus = Total
Money.
In step 3, he multiplied the variable by the base monthly cost instead of by the
cost per GB.
